The Role of Emotional Intelligence in Running a Thriving Dental Practice
In a profession rooted in clinical expertise and technical precision, it’s easy to overlook one of the most powerful tools in your leadership toolbox: emotional intelligence (EQ). But the truth is, your ability to understand, manage, and respond to emotions—both your own and those of your team and patients—can have a greater impact on your practice’s success than any technology or treatment plan.
At its core, emotional intelligence is about awareness and connection. High-EQ leaders remain calm under pressure, communicate clearly, and build stronger relationships. In a busy dental practice, where stress can run high and interactions are frequent, EQ becomes the glue that holds everything together.
Start with self-awareness. Do you know how your mood affects your team? When challenges arise—whether it’s a last-minute cancellation or a staff conflict—how do you react? Dentists who lead with self-awareness recognize when they’re feeling stressed or frustrated and learn to pause before responding. That emotional regulation sets the tone for everyone around them.
Empathy is another essential element of EQ—especially in patient care. Many patients walk into your office with fear or anxiety. Being able to read their body language, listen actively, and respond with compassion can transform their experience. It’s not just about fixing teeth—it’s about making people feel safe and understood.
With your team, emotional intelligence builds trust and morale. When employees feel heard, respected, and supported, they’re more engaged and more loyal. That’s why high-EQ practice owners regularly check in with staff—not just on performance, but on how they’re doing personally. A small gesture, like asking how someone’s weekend was or recognizing a personal milestone, can go a long way in building a positive culture.
Conflict resolution is another area where EQ shines. Rather than avoiding difficult conversations or reacting defensively, emotionally intelligent leaders approach conflict with curiosity and clarity. They seek to understand before being understood—and that leads to faster, healthier resolutions.
The good news? EQ can be developed. Through coaching, reading, feedback, and reflection, you can grow your emotional intelligence just like any other skill.
In today’s dental landscape, technical skill gets you in the game—but emotional intelligence sets you apart. When you lead with heart and awareness, you don’t just build a practice that runs smoothly—you create a place where people want to work, patients want to return, and success becomes inevitable.
